In Ubuntu 11.10, setting up AirPrint is easy.

1. Have a Standard install of Ubuntu Desktop 11.10.
2. Go into the CUPS interface and make sure “Share published printers connected to this system” is enabled on the server settings.
3. On the Printer Properties, make sure the Shared checkbox is check on the Policies tab.
4. If you have a firewall running, make sure you allow the needed ports (one of the is port 631).
5. Restart CUPS “/etc/init.d/cups restart” or reboot the computer
6. Make sure you iPhone/iPad is on the same network
7. On your iPhone/iPad, go into Safari, print, and search for printers. Your new printer should be in there.
